[TYPO3-german] Performanceprobleme TYPO3 4.2 Beta 2

Steffen Ritter info at rs-websystems.de
Sun Feb 24 17:14:09 CET 2008


Hallo Sebastian,
ich arbeite auch schon seit einigen Wocehen mit 4.2 aber bei ist das 
gegenteil der Fall, Typo3 4.2 ist bei mir um einiges schneller... 
Allergings habe ich noch keine absolut messungen gemacht wie du jetzt...
Woran das allerdings liegen könnte weiß ich jetzt nicht, ich gehe davon 
aus, dass du alle DB updates ,Updatewizards, Caches löschen und 
ähnlcihes ordentlich ggemacht hast... Wenn du noch eine Testseite ohne 
TV hast mach mal gleiches dort, und schau ob das gleiche bei herauskommt.

mfG

Steffen

Sebastian Widmann schrieb:
> Hallo,
> 
> ich habe gestern mal mein Testsystem auf T3 4.2 Beta 2 aktualisiert und 
> habe seitdem extreme Performance-Probleme. Jetzt habe ich mir gerade mal 
> die Rendering-Zeiten ausgeben lassen (Ausgabe siehe unten - sehr 
> unübersichtlich!) und dabei festgestellt, dass beim Schritt: "Get Page 
> from cache" zwischen 30 und 60 Sekunden ins Land ziehen. Hat außer mir 
> noch jemand diese Probleme oder liegt das an meiner Konfiguration?
> 
> Viele Grüße
> Sebastian
> 
> PS: Hier die Ausgabe:
> Script Start           0      6      +31876      =31882    
> ...ass t3lib_db, t3lib_div, t3lib_extmgm          0     13              
> /Include config files          13     4     +6     =10    
> ...iles/Loading localconf.php extensions          15     6              
> /Include Frontend libraries          23     62              
> /Front End user initialized          89     2              
> /Back End user initialized          91     55              
> /Process ID          146     0     +4     =4    
> /Process ID/beUserLogin          146     1              
> /Process ID/fetch_the_id initialize/          147     1              
> /Process ID/fetch_the_id domain/          148     1              
> /Process ID/fetch_the_id rootLine/          149     1              
> /Get Compressed TC array          151     1              
> /Start Template          152     0              
> /Get Page from cache          152     31512              
> /Parse template          31664     6              
> /Setting the config-array          31670     0              
> /Page generation          31670     14     +185     =199    
> /Page generation/pagegen.php, initialize          31683     
> 29              
> /Page generation/pagegen.php, render          31712     0     +83     
> =83    
> page     PAGE     31712     12     +71     =83    
> page.10     USER     31712     3     +68     =71    
> page.10.Processing data          31715     2     +63     =65    
> ...TemplaVoila_ProcObjPath--lib*topMenu.     HMENU     31716     
> 5              
> ...0.Processing data.TemplaVoila_Proc.10     RECORDS     31721     1     
> +50     =51    
> ....Processing data.TemplaVoila_Proc.10.     <tt_content     31722     
> 0     +50     =50    
> tt_content
> ....Processing data.TemplaVoila_Proc.10.     CASE     31722     1     
> +49     =50    
> tt_content.templavoila_pi1
> ....Processing data.TemplaVoila_Proc.10.     COA     31722     1     
> +48     =49    
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     < plugin.tx_templavoila_pi1 
> 31723     0     +48     =48    
> plugin.tx_templavoila_pi1
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     USER     31723     1     
> +47     =48    
> ...in.tx_templavoila_pi1.Processing data
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.          31724     1     
> +45     =46    
> ...1.Processing data.TemplaVoila_Proc.10
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RECORDS     31725     
> 12     +11     =23    
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     <tt_content     31737     
> 0     +7     =7    
> tt_content
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31737     1     
> +6     =7    
> tt_content.text
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     COA     31737     0     
> +6     =6    
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     < lib.stdheader     31737 
> 0     +2     =2    
> lib.stdheader
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     COA     31737     1     
> +1     =2    
> lib.stdheader.2
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     LOAD_REGISTER     31738     
> 0              
> lib.stdheader.3
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     LOAD_REGISTER     31738     
> 0              
> lib.stdheader.5
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31738     
> 0              
> lib.stdheader.10
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31738     0     
> +1     =1    
> lib.stdheader.10.1
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31738     
> 1              
> lib.stdheader.98
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RESTORE_REGISTER     
> 31739     0              
> lib.stdheader.99
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RESTORE_REGISTER     
> 31739     0              
> tt_content.text.20
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31739     3     
> +1     =4    
> tt_content.text.20./parseFunc/.tags.link
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31741     
> 1              
> tt_content./stdWrap/.cObject
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31743     
> 0              
> tt_content./stdWrap/.cObject.default
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.          31743     0              
> tt_content./stdWrap/.prepend
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31743     
> 0              
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     <tt_content     31744     
> 0     +4     =4    
> tt_content
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31744     1     
> +3     =4    
> tt_content.text
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     COA     31744     0     
> +3     =3    
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     < lib.stdheader     31744 
> 0     +1     =1    
> lib.stdheader
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     COA     31744     0     
> +1     =1    
> lib.stdheader.2
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     LOAD_REGISTER     31744     
> 0              
> lib.stdheader.3
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     LOAD_REGISTER     31744     
> 0              
> lib.stdheader.5
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31744     
> 0              
> lib.stdheader.10
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31744     
> 1              
> lib.stdheader.10.1
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31745     
> 0              
> lib.stdheader.98
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RESTORE_REGISTER     
> 31745     0              
> lib.stdheader.99
> tt_content.text.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RESTORE_REGISTER     
> 31745     0              
> tt_content.text.20
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31745     
> 2              
> tt_content./stdWrap/.cObject
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31747     
> 0              
> tt_content./stdWrap/.cObject.default
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.          31747     0              
> tt_content./stdWrap/.prepend
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31748     
> 0              
> ...1.Processing data.TemplaVoila_Proc.10
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RECORDS     31748     1     
> +21     =22    
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     <tt_content     31749     
> 0     +21     =21    
> tt_content
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31749     1     
> +20     =21    
> tt_content.menu
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     COA     31749     1     
> +19     =20    
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     < lib.stdheader     31750 
> 0     +1     =1    
> lib.stdheader
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     COA     31750     0     
> +1     =1    
> lib.stdheader.2
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     LOAD_REGISTER     31750     
> 0              
> lib.stdheader.3
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     LOAD_REGISTER     31750     
> 0              
> lib.stdheader.5
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31750     
> 0              
> lib.stdheader.10
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31750     
> 1              
> lib.stdheader.10.1
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31751     
> 0              
> lib.stdheader.98
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RESTORE_REGISTER     
> 31751     0              
> lib.stdheader.99
> tt_content.menu.10
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     RESTORE_REGISTER     
> 31751     0              
> tt_content.menu.20
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31751     0     
> +18     =18    
> tt_content.menu.20.1
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     HMENU     31751     
> 18              
> tt_content./stdWrap/.cObject
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     CASE     31769     
> 0              
> tt_content./stdWrap/.cObject.default
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.          31769     0              
> tt_content./stdWrap/.prepend
> ....Processing data.TemplaVoila_Proc.10.
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31769     
> 0              
> ....tx_templavoila_pi1.Merge data and TO
> tt_content.templavoila_pi1.20
> ....Processing data.TemplaVoila_Proc.10.          31770     1              
> tt_content./stdWrap/.cObject
> ....Processing data.TemplaVoila_Proc.10.     CASE     31771     
> 0              
> tt_content./stdWrap/.cObject.default
> ....Processing data.TemplaVoila_Proc.10.          31771     0              
> tt_content./stdWrap/.prepend
> ....Processing data.TemplaVoila_Proc.10.     TEXT     31771     
> 0              
> ....TemplaVoila_ProcObjPath--lib*footer.     COA     31772     0     
> +3     =3    
> ...mplaVoila_ProcObjPath--lib*footer..10     HMENU     31772     
> 3              
> ...mplaVoila_ProcObjPath--lib*footer..20     TEXT     31775     
> 0              
> ...mplaVoila_ProcObjPath--lib*clickpath.     HMENU     31776     
> 1              
> ...mplaVoila_ProcObjPath--lib*pagetitle.     TEXT     31777     
> 1              
> ...laVoila_ProcObjPath--lib*searchfield.     USER     31778     1     
> +1     =2    
> ...ib*searchfield..substituteMarkerArray          31779     1              
> page.10.Merge data and TO          31780     3              
> /Page generation/XHTML clean, all          31795     10              
> /Page generation/Tidy, cached          31805     0              
> /Page generation/Index page          31805     4     +59     =63    
> ...e generation/Index page/Split content          31809     0              
> ...g charset of content (utf-8) to utf-8          31809     0              
> ...Index page/Extract words from content          31809     
> 12              
> ...ndex page/Analyse the extracted words          31821     1              
> ...generation/Index page/Submitting page          31822     
> 13              
> ...page/Check word list and submit words          31835     
> 31              
> ...on/Index page/Checking external files          31866     2              
> /Print Content          31870     12              
> /Stat          31882     0              


More information about the TYPO3-german mailing list